140. Kapfenberger appointed GM of Grand Copthorne Waterfront Hotel Singapore
Heinrich L Kapfenberger appointed General Manager of Grand Copthorne Waterfront Hotel Singapore. Mr. Heinrich L Kapfenberger has been appointed as General Manager of the Grand Copthorne Waterfront Hotel Singapore. He joins the hotel from the Millennium Hotel & Resort, Stuttgart, where he served as General Manager.

142. AirAsia Launches Promotion to Celebrate 100th Airbus A320
AirAsia welcomed the arrival of its 100th Airbus A320 on Thursday. Together with its affiliates in Indonesia and Thailand, AirAsia operates the Airbus A320 aircraft for its entire route network throughout the region. Currently, both the Malaysia and Thailand operations are fully Airbus, while the Indonesia operations will be 100% Airbus by end of Q1 2012.
